I expect you to get off the ship between 6-7:30 am in the morning. Usually the cruise tours get off first.

 

There will not be time to see "Whittier". Though, there is very little to see in Whittier so it is not as big of a loss as missing Seward.

 

Technically on Princess you can purchase spirits and take them with you when you disembark, but I am not sure how that would work on a cruise tour as you may put your luggage out the night before (and there is limited storage on the train). Sorry - can't answer this.
